I've been distro-hopping among Ubuntu- and Debian-derived distros, all with KDE desktop, and using Vivaldi browser.

RHP's standard set of emojis/emotis is not coming through correctly.

Is it just a matter of installing a certain font package?

SOLVED:

I just had to install this package:
fonts-noto-color-emoji

then restart my browser.

Distros not based on Debian might name the package differently, e.g., noto-color-emoji.
